Meaning of interestingly

The primary meaning of "interestingly" is to describe something that is intriguing or engaging.

Etymology of interestingly

The word "interestingly" is derived from the word "interesting", which originated from the Old French word "interesse", meaning "to be of concern to" or "to have an interest in"
Historically, the word "interesting" emerged in the 18th century, and the adverbial form "interestingly" developed later to describe the manner in which something is interesting

Definitions

  • In a way that is interesting or attractive, holding one's attention
  • * In a manner that arouses curiosity or catches the attention

Usage Examples

  • The professor spoke interestingly about the historical event, captivating the audience's attention
  • * The documentary presented the facts interestingly, making the complex topic more engaging
